Masterpieces of Ancient Egypt by Nigel Strudwick

The British Museum has the largest and finest collection of antiquities from Egypt and the Sudan outside of those countries. Masterpieces of Ancient Egypt presents the highlights of the British Museum's Egyptian collection for the first time in print. This beautiful volume displays 200 of the most important and famous objects, including the Rosetta Stone, as well as a selection of lesser-known but equally significant pieces. Together, these works offer an overview of the whole of ancient Egyptian art. Each object is illustrated with a full-page color photograph, many of which were taken especially for this publication. The accompanying text unfolds the story and features of each object. The introduction offers a brief history of the vast collections of the Department of Ancient Egypt and Sudan and a description of how and why items are selected for display in the permanent galleries of the British Museum.
